I can see the appeal of a 911 John and have driven and considered a few. On the plus side is the compact format, immense traction and the security of 4WD on the right models. On the downside though:
1. you'll be less likely to be let out of junctions and more likely to get vandalised
2. you've said before that you value crisp turn-in more highly than noise. Well they sound like washing machines which is ok but their turn in is surprisingly poor. Just not enough weight over the front makes the front dampers/springs relatively hard = you've got to nurse them and feel them into a corner, they don't bite the corner properly. Once into the bend then they are fabulous and are unbeatable on the way out. Ok they are sharp and darty at the front end, but this rapid response isn't the same as grip. Turn the wheel and they instantly respond but then you find they are all shout and no trousers and the car just isn't turned into the bend properly.
Cars with small footprint, big turn-in grip and all-weather traction, apart from (arguably) an RS3, is a very short list.
